Boys' Varsity Soccer Win! "An Exciting Match From Start To Finish."

Coach Wainio
On a beautiful sunny day, the Owls varsity soccer team traveled to New Haven to face the Foote School.  The teams were evenly matched and play was spirited.  The boys tallied the first goal on a tremendous corner kick from Sam ‘22 that curled into the goal.  Then Foote grabbed the momentum and scored the next three goals, putting the Owls back 3-1.  Gabe ‘22 moved up from his defensive position to score the second goal of the game, reducing the lead to just one goal.  After halftime, Sam ‘22 took another marvelous corner kick which struck a Foote player and bounced into the goal.  The game was tied.  With some incredible defensive play from Luca ‘23, Oli ‘23, Jack ‘22 and Gabe ‘22, the Owls were able to hold Foote at bay.  Andrew ‘23 took over as the goalkeeper and did a fantastic job handling everything that came into his box.  Blake ‘22 scored the next two goals on passes from Harrison ‘22.  With the score now 5-3, Foote was able to scratch back one more goal on an own goal.  When the horn from the scoreboard sounded, the score was 5-4, and the Owls were victorious.  It was an exciting match from start to finish!  Thank you to Mr. Birdsall for his coaching wisdom on the sidelines and to Mr. Fixx for driving the van to the game.  Also, many thanks to all the parents who came and gave us great support and water!
